Introduction to Legacy Systems

Definition and Importance

Legacy systems are outdated software or hardware that still play a critical role in financial institutions . They often handle essential functions such as transaction processing and data management. Despite their age, these systems can be deeply integrated into an organization’s operations. Many companies rely on them for stability and reliability. This reliance can create significant challenges when considering modernization. Change is often met with resistance. The financial sector must balance innovation wlth risk management. It’s a delicate dance. Legacy systems can hinder agility and responsiveness. Are we ready to evolve?

Challenges Faced by Legacy Systems

Legacy systems often present significant challenges in the financial sector. They can be inflexible and difficult to integrate with modern technologies. This lack of compatibility can lead to inefficiencies. Many organizations struggle to maintain these systems due to their complexity. He may find that support for outdated software is limited. This can result in increased operational risks. Additionally, legacy systems may not comply with current regulatory standards. Compliance is crucial in finance. The cost of maintaining these systems can escalate quickly. Is it worth the investment?

Innovative Approaches to Reviving Legacy Systems

Modernization Strategies

Modernization strategies for legacy systems focus on enhancing efficiency and compliance. Organizations often consider cloud migration as a primary solution. This approach can reduce operational costs significantly. He may find improved scalability and flexibility. Additionally, integrating APIs can facilitate better interoperability with new technologies. This integration is crucial for maintaining competitive advantage. Many firms also explore adopting microservices architecture. It allows for incremental updates without disrupting core functions. Is this the future of software? Embracing these strategies can lead to sustainable growth.

    Technological Tools for Transformation

    Cloud Migration Solutions

    Cloud migration solutions offer significant advantages for financial institutions. They enhance scalability and reduce infrastructure costs. He may experience improved data accessibility and security. Utilizing platforms like AWS or Azure can streamline operations. These tools facilitate seamless integration with existing systems. Many organizations also benefit from automated compliance features. This ensures adherence to regulatory standards. Is this the future of finance? The transition can lead to greater operational efficiency.

    Best Practices for Managing Legacy Systems

    Assessment and Planning

    Assessment and planning are critical for managing legacy systems effectively. Organizations must conduct a thorough evaluation of existing infrastructure. This includes identifying key functionalities and potential risks. He should prioritize systems that are most critical to operations. Additionally, developing a clear roadmap for modernization is essential. This roadmap should outline timelines and resource allocation. Many firms benefit from engaging stakeholders early in the process. Collaboration fosters a shared understanding of goals. Is there a comprehensive strategy in place? A well-structured plan can mitigate disruptions during transitions.
